Petrol has appointed Metod Podkriznik and Drago Kavsek as board members. Petrol's supervisory board unanimously adopted a resolution on appointing the two board members, on a proposal by management board president Saso Berger, for a five-year term of office, the energy group said in a bourse filing last week. Podkriznik is set to commence duties on Petrol's management board from January 1, 2024, focusing on overseeing B2B and B2G sales, whereas Kavsek, who will handle finance, information, and risk-related matters, will officially assume the role starting February 1, 2024.

With the appointments, Petrol's management board will revert to its composition of six members, the company noted. Earlier this month, Petrol's board member Matija Bitenc resigned to focus on his role as general manager of wholesale natural gas supplier Geoplin. The function of Bitenc as board member of Petrol ended on December 8, but he will remain with the company until January 4, 2024, to hand over his duties and responsibilities, Petrol said back then.
